The Strait of Messina was successfully traversed by a group of 30 fearless swimmers from various regions of Italy yesterday morning, who defied the open sea and its currents by swimming stroke after stroke. An even more remarkable achievement because it was carried out by Parkinson's patients alongside their families, and the neurologists who treat them. The LIMPE Foundation for Parkinson Onlus is currently promoting the Swim for Parkinson initiative, which is in its fourth edition. The purpose of this initiative is to increase public awareness of this neurodegenerative disease and to raise funds for the Outdoor Project, which aims to enhance the quality of life of individuals with Parkinson's disease through physical activity.
